Mirram crept silently to the gunyah, 1923. How the kangaroo got a long tail, and the wombat a flat forehead; Mirram the kangaroo creeping into Warreen the wombats tent to punish him for his selfishness at not letting Mirram share his tent in the storm. From Some Myths and Legends of the Australian Aborigines by WJ Thomas, 1923
